Construction Project Management Consultant

Banner Health

Construction Project Manager managing healthcare construction and renovation projects for Banner Health. Ensuring project delivery on time, within budget, and regulatory compliance.

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• This role manages project budgets, schedules, quality, safety, and regulatory compliance while collaborating with hospital leadership, architects, contractors, and cross-functional teams.
  • Ensures projects are delivered on time, within budget, and with minimal disruption to operations.
  • Provides leadership by directing project teams, architects and contractor activities.
  • Develops project schedules for assigned projects and manages all team members to ensure coordinated, timely execution and completion of projects.
  • Prepares and evaluates projects, generates cost estimates, reads and interprets design documents, and reviews for completeness and quality, i.e. maintenance, construction, code compliance, and function.
  • Ensures JCAHO, safety and code compliance is achieved on all projects.
  • Monitors and maintains project related documents including RFIs, Proposal Requests, Change Orders, testing and inspection reports, lien notices and purchase requisitions.
  • Mitigates project risk by identifying potential issues including site logistics, disruptions to operations, existing conditions and maintenance concerns.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Must possess a strong knowledge of architecture, construction, and/or engineering as normally demonstrated through the completion of a bachelor’s degree in architecture, construction management, engineering or related field.
  • Five years of progressive project management experience preferably in healthcare related construction.
  • Must have proven experience directing and managing multiple resources and projects.
  • Ability to read and interpret blue prints, specifications and related contract regulatory documents.
  • Must possess a thorough working knowledge of building codes, materials and standards and project tracking tools.
  • Must be able to compute job costs, prepare and monitor project budgets and schedules, a well as use and interpret typical contracts and agreements.
  • Requires strong written, verbal and interpersonal communications skills to motivate team performance.
  • Requires ability listen, negotiate, and resolve conflicts.
  • Must be able to work independently and effectively align resources to achieve system goals.
  • Must exercise independent judgment and be able to maintain confidential information.
